Block Size Considerations

Block

The fundamental unit of data storage within a blockchain, block size directly influences transaction throughput and network scalability. Larger block sizes can accommodate more transactions per block, potentially increasing speed but also raising concerns about centralization and increased bandwidth requirements for nodes. Conversely, smaller block sizes limit transaction capacity, potentially leading to slower confirmation times and higher transaction fees, impacting overall network efficiency. Optimizing block size involves a delicate balance between these competing factors, often necessitating adjustments based on network demand and technological advancements.
